Crafting 3D Motif Greeting Cards Yourself

Crafting 3D Motif Greeting Cards
Creating personalized 3D greeting cards is a rewarding hobby that brings joy to recipients. This guide outlines the process and materials needed to craft these unique cards.
Required Materials
- 3D motifs (available at craft stores or online)
- Various small scissors
- Double-sided adhesive pads (white or black)
- Self-adhesive craft pearls
- Glitter stones
- Self-adhesive ribbons and borders
- Square or rectangular cards with matching envelopes
- Craft glue (optional)
- Tweezers (recommended)
- Ruler
- Glitter dust
- Clear nail polish (can be used as a substitute for clear varnish)
Step-by-Step Guide to Creating 3D Motifs
Preparation
- Select a Motif: Choose a motif appropriate for the occasion.
- Select a Card: Decide whether to use a square or rectangular card.
- Gather Embellishments: Prepare ribbons, pearls, glitter stones, glue, and scissors.
Creating the 3D Motif
- Cut Out Motifs: Each 3D motif typically consists of 4-5 layers. Carefully cut out each image, ensuring each subsequent layer is slightly smaller than the previous one.
- Apply Adhesive Pads: Place double-sided adhesive pads at intervals on the back of the first cutout. Then, attach the second, slightly smaller cutout onto the pads.
- Layer the Motifs: Continue layering the cutouts, using adhesive pads between each piece to build the 3D effect.
- Embellish the Card: Decorate the card’s edge with ribbons, corner borders, glitter stones, or pearls.
- Add Depth: The 3D motif can be adhered to a lace doily for added texture and decorated further as desired.
- Final Embellishments: Add pearls or glitter stones to any remaining small spaces.
- Apply Glitter Dust: Paint the motif with clear nail polish and sprinkle glitter dust over it.
- Allow to Dry: Let the card dry completely.
